CISUtility

@interface CISUtility : NSObject

+(int) NumberToUnsignedInt:(NSNumber *)number result:(int)defaultResult;
+(BOOL) isValidString:(NSString *)string;
+(double)timeBetweenTimeEarlier:(double)timeEarlier andTimeLater:(double)timeLater;
+ (dispatch_queue_t)cisSharedQueue;
+ (BOOL)isCISSharedQueue;
+ (void)dispatchAsyncToCISSharedQueue:(dispatch_block_t)block;
+ (void)optionalDispatchAsyncToCISSharedQueue:(dispatch_block_t)block;
+ (void)sanitiseTag:(NSMutableDictionary *)custom;
+ (NSString *)describeError:(NSError *)error;

+ (id)getClientId;
+ (void)setClientId:(NSString *)newClientId;
@end

Undocumented

  • Undocumented

    Declaration

    Objective-C

    +(int) NumberToUnsignedInt:(NSNumber *)number result:(int)defaultResult;

    Swift

    class func number(toUnsignedInt number: NSNumber!, result defaultResult: Int32) -> Int32
  • Undocumented

    Declaration

    Objective-C

    +(BOOL) isValidString:(NSString *)string;

    Swift

    class func isValidString(_ string: String!) -> Bool
  • Undocumented

    Declaration

    Objective-C

    +(double)timeBetweenTimeEarlier:(double)timeEarlier andTimeLater:(double)timeLater;

    Swift

    class func timeBetweenTimeEarlier(_ timeEarlier: Double, andTimeLater timeLater: Double) -> Double
  • Undocumented

    Declaration

    Objective-C

    + (dispatch_queue_t)cisSharedQueue;

    Swift

    class func cisSharedQueue() -> DispatchQueue!
  • Undocumented

    Declaration

    Objective-C

    + (BOOL)isCISSharedQueue;

    Swift

    class func isCISSharedQueue() -> Bool
  • Undocumented

    Declaration

    Objective-C

    + (void)dispatchAsyncToCISSharedQueue:(dispatch_block_t)block;

    Swift

    class func dispatchAsync(toCISSharedQueue block: (() -> Void)!)
  • Undocumented

    Declaration

    Objective-C

    + (void)optionalDispatchAsyncToCISSharedQueue:(dispatch_block_t)block;

    Swift

    class func optionalDispatchAsync(toCISSharedQueue block: (() -> Void)!)
  • Undocumented

    Declaration

    Objective-C

    + (void)sanitiseTag:(NSMutableDictionary *)custom;

    Swift

    class func sanitiseTag(_ custom: NSMutableDictionary!)
  • Undocumented

    Declaration

    Objective-C

    + (NSString *)describeError:(NSError *)error;

    Swift

    class func describeError(_ error: Error!) -> String!
  • Undocumented

    Declaration

    Objective-C

    + (id)getClientId;

    Swift

    class func getClientId() -> Any!
  • Undocumented

    Declaration

    Objective-C

    + (void)setClientId:(NSString *)newClientId;

    Swift

    class func setClientId(_ newClientId: String!)